Subject: [RFC v4 19/21] ath10k: add QCA9377 usb hw_param item

Hardware parameters for QCA9377 usb devices.

Signed-off-by: Erik Stromdahl <erik.stromdahl@gmail.com>
---
 dr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/core.c | 23 +++++++++++++++++++++++
 dr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/hw.h   |  1 +
 2 files changed, 24 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/core.c b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/core.c
index 2e2d3d3..96b278b 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/core.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/core.c
@@ -288,6 +288,29 @@ static const struct ath10k_hw_params ath10k_hw_params_list[] = {
 		.decap_align_bytes = 4,
 	},
 	{
+		.id = QCA9377_HW_1_1_DEV_VERSION,
+		.dev_id = QCA9377_1_0_DEVICE_ID,
+		.name = "qca9377 hw1.1 usb",
+		.patch_load_addr = QCA9377_HW_1_0_PATCH_LOAD_ADDR,
+		.uart_pin = 6,
+		.otp_exe_param = 0,
+		.channel_counters_freq_hz = 88000,
+		.max_probe_resp_desc_thres = 0,
+		.cal_data_len = 8124,
+		.fw = {
+			.dir = QCA9377_HW_1_0_FW_DIR,
+			.board = QCA9377_HW_1_0_BOARD_DATA_FILE_USB,
+			.board_size = QCA9377_BOARD_DATA_SZ,
+			.board_ext_size = QCA9377_BOARD_EXT_DATA_SZ,
+		},
+		.hw_ops = &qca988x_ops,
+		.decap_align_bytes = 4,
+		.max_num_peers = TARGET_QCA9377_HL_NUM_PEERS,
+		.is_high_latency = true,
+		.bus = ATH10K_BUS_USB,
+		.start_once = true,
+	},
+	{
 		.id = QCA4019_HW_1_0_DEV_VERSION,
 		.dev_id = 0,
 		.name = "qca4019 hw1.0",
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/hw.h b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/hw.h
index cf88aba..5408ebc 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/hw.h
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ath10k/hw.h
@@ -127,6 +127,7 @@ enum qca9377_chip_id_rev {
 /* QCA9377 1.0 definitions */
 #define QCA9377_HW_1_0_FW_DIR          ATH10K_FW_DIR "/QCA9377/hw1.0"
 #define QCA9377_HW_1_0_BOARD_DATA_FILE "board.bin"
+#define QCA9377_HW_1_0_BOARD_DATA_FILE_USB "board-usb.bin"
 #define QCA9377_HW_1_0_PATCH_LOAD_ADDR	0x1234
